Title :
Stimulated emission from silicon nanocrystals by two-photon excitation in CW operation

Abstract :
The superlinear emission of two-photon excited fluorescence from the silicon particles are observed under CW laser excitation, and the emission is attributed to stimulated emission. The silicon particles were produced by a ns pulse laser.
